The university-recognized, student-led athletic organization provides an opportunity for individuals to participate in competitive baseball beyond the varsity level. This entity operates outside the formal intercollegiate athletic program, offering a structured environment for skill development, teamwork, and sportsmanship. For example, tryouts are held annually to form a team that represents the university in regional and national club baseball competitions.
Participation in this type of organization offers several benefits, including increased physical activity, enhanced leadership skills, and the fostering of camaraderie amongst members. Historically, such groups have served as a vital outlet for students passionate about the sport, allowing them to continue playing competitively while pursuing their academic goals. The existence of this outlet cultivates a well-rounded university experience, promoting both athletic and academic achievement.
